He was retired after 32 years at The Kroot Corporation in Columbus. He loved the Lord and was a member of the Church of Jesus Christ at Easyville. Garry also enjoyed playing guitar, fishing, working puzzles, technology and electronics and spending time with his family.
Garry is survived by his wife of almost 46 years and the love of his life, Nan; children, Garry Barrett of Ogden, UT, Steve Barrett of Vernon, and Julie (William Allman) Barrett-Kelly of North Vernon; Grandchildren, Heather Nicole Schmidlap, Sophie Barrett, Sam Barrett, Dillon, Blake Mills and an unborn granddaughter Juliana. Garry is also survived by 10 siblings, Larry (Verda) Barrett, Linda (Benny) Barger, Brenda (Gary) Campbell, Darlene Barrett, Teresa (Jerry) Cole, Kenneth (Judy) Barrett, Lynette Wolfe, Jeff (Paige) Barrett, Jerry Barrett and Greg (Jane) Barrett. Garry also had several nieces and nephews who survive him.
He was preceded in death by his parents and a brother-in-law, Phillip Wolfe; niece, Kelly Wolfe; nephews, Phillip Edward Wolfe and Danny Hines.
Pastor Jean Pogue will conduct funeral services at 11:00am on Monday, July 20th at Woodlawn Life Celebration Centre at 311 Holiday Sq. Rd in Seymour. Visitation will be on Sunday from 2:00pm until 6:00pm and from 10:00am until service time on Monday at the funeral. Burial will follow services at Riverview Cemetery.
